Why UPS Sizing Matters for Your Business
A properly sized UPS acts like a safety net for your critical systems. Too small, and it might fail during an outage. Too large, and you'll waste money on unnecessary capacity. Let's break down the key factors to consider:
Step 1: Calculate Your Total Load Requirements
- List all connected equipment: Servers, routers, cooling systems, etc.
- Check power ratings: Look for wattage (W) or volt-amps (VA) on device labels
- Account for startup surges: Motors and compressors may need 2-3x their running power
Real-World Example: A mid-sized data center with 20 servers (300W each) and 5 cooling units (800W each) requires:
(20 × 300W) + (5 × 800W) = 6,000W + 4,000W = 10,000W (10kW)
Step 2: Understand Runtime Requirements
How long do you need backup power? Typical requirements vary by industry:

Avoid These Common UPS Sizing Mistakes
- Ignoring future expansion needs
- Mixing VA and Watts without conversion (W = VA × power factor)
- Forgetting about environmental factors (temperature affects battery life)

Advanced Sizing Techniques
Modular UPS Systems
Scale your power protection as needs evolve. Modular units let you add capacity in 10kW increments – perfect for growing businesses.
Three-Phase vs Single-Phase
- Single-phase: <20 kVA (small offices)
- Three-phase: >20 kVA (industrial applications)

FAQ: UPS Sizing Questions Answered
Can I use multiple smaller UPS units instead of one large system?
Yes, through parallel redundancy configurations. This approach improves reliability but requires professional installation.
How often should I reevaluate my UPS size?
Conduct load audits every 12-18 months, or whenever adding significant equipment.
